How Much is Lagos to Abuja by Road?

The price of a trip from Lagos to Abuja by road is influenced by several factors. On average, the cost can range from N20,000 to N30,000. However, it’s crucial to note that these rates are subject to change and may fluctuate depending on the time of year, fuel prices, and the company you choose for your journey.

Transport Companies and Their Prices: Lagos to Abuja by Road

Several transport companies operate on this route, offering a range of services and prices to cater to different traveler preferences. Some of the well-known companies you can consider include ABC Transport, God Is Good Motors (GIGM), and Peace Mass Transit. Each of these companies provides varying levels of comfort and services, which can affect the price of your ticket.

Travel Time from Lagos to Abuja

The travel time from Lagos to Abuja by road varies depending on factors such as traffic conditions and the route taken. On average, it takes approximately 10 hrs 30 mins to 12 hours to cover the distance, which is approximately 536 kilometers. It’s advisable to plan your departure time to avoid heavy traffic, especially when leaving Lagos.

Which road is best from Lagos to Abuja?

Lagos – Akure – Owo – Ibilo – Okene – Lokoja – Abuja route is the most popular because public transport companies operating between Lagos and Abuja often use it.
